Transaction 381d8114aae7f56d23c05dc8fea7d9be34c123ff0e50c7f2e09cb7f030adbea5
1 Input
1 Output
-
381d8114aae7f56d23c05dc8fea7d9be34c123ff0e50c7f2e09cb7f030adbea5:0
- value
- 101398
- script pubkey
- OP_0 OP_PUSHBYTES_20 10f5878e5d3d77635f1056120d90b4c034cd59b2
- address
- bc1qzr6c0rja84mkxhcs2cfqmy95cq6v6kdjf0t4f9